We're observing this issue more and more as the OptiBay (and OWC Data Doubler and other equivalents) become popular choices for MacBook Pro users. We have several Communities threads on the topic by now, but I haven't found the root cause yet. It seems remarkably unpredictable... we've had users report that the problem is triggered (or is cured!) by switching between wireless and wired networking or between battery and AC power, or by putting the MacBook to sleep and waking it, etc. There seems to be no rhyme or reason to it, and what fixes the problem in one case will trigger it in another.
If you'd like to help us figure out the problem, could you please:
- provide your system's Model Identifier from System Profiler (i.e. MacBookPro5,1)
- provide the brand and model for your storage devices? Did you move the original HDD to the optical bay, did it remain in its original location, or was it removed from the system?
- Try disabling the Sudden Motion Sensor, as described here.
